Marvel's upcoming Vision Quest series is reportedly resurrecting a villain from the very first MCU film, Iron Man.
Deadline reports that Faran Tahir will reprise his role as Raza Hamidmi al-Wazar, the Afghan terrorist leader who held Tony Stark captive in the opening scenes of Iron Man, nearly two decades later. His betrayal by Obadiah Stane (Jeff Bridges) marked his last MCU appearance until now.
While absent from the MCU since Iron Man's initial 30 minutes in 2008, al-Wazar's return mirrors the reappearance of Samuel Sterns (The Incredible Hulk) in Captain America: Brave New World. The Vision Quest series, starring Paul Bettany as White Vision following WandaVision, currently lacks a release date.

Similar to Deadpool & Wolverine's exploration of the discarded Fox Marvel universe, Vision Quest might delve into previously overlooked MCU elements. The series will also feature the return of James Spader as Ultron, his first appearance since Avengers: Age of Ultron, though details remain scarce.
